The Rising Demand for Chronic Disease Management and Preventive Healthcare in the UK Pharmacy Market
The UK pharmacy market is witnessing a paradigm shift driven by the rising demand for chronic disease management services and a growing interest in preventive healthcare. As the prevalence of chronic conditions such as diabetes, hypertension, and asthma increases, pharmacies are evolving into accessible healthcare providers offering medication management, health screenings, and lifestyle advice. The market, valued at USD 55.55 billion in 2024, is projected to grow steadily to USD 91.13 billion by 2035, underscoring the impact of these transformative trends. The Growing Burden of Chronic Diseases
Increasing Prevalence of Chronic Conditions
The pharmacy market in the UK is experiencing a notable increase in demand for chronic disease management services. This trend is largely driven by the rising prevalence of chronic conditions such as diabetes, hypertension, and asthma. As of 2025, approximately 15 million people in the UK are living with a chronic disease, which represents around 30% of the adult population. Pharmacies are increasingly positioned as accessible healthcare providers, offering medication management, health screenings, and lifestyle advice. This shift enhances patient outcomes and positions pharmacies as integral players in the healthcare system.
Impact on Pharmacy Services
The growing burden of chronic diseases is prompting pharmacies to adapt their service offerings. Pharmacies are diversifying beyond traditional medication dispensing to provide additional health services, such as vaccinations, health screenings, and clinical consultations. This expansion aligns with government initiatives to enhance public health and reflects a broader trend towards integrated healthcare models. Pharmacies are increasingly partnering with general practitioners and hospitals to ensure seamless patient transitions and continuity of care.
The Shift Towards Preventive Healthcare
Growing Consumer Interest in Prevention
There is a growing interest in preventive healthcare within the pharmacy market in the UK. Consumers are increasingly seeking services that promote health and well-being, rather than merely treating illnesses. This trend is reflected in the rising demand for health screenings, vaccinations, and wellness consultations offered by pharmacies. As of 2025, it is estimated that the preventive healthcare segment could account for up to 25% of pharmacy services.
Role of Pharmacies in Public Health
The shift towards prevention empowers patients to take charge of their health and positions pharmacies as key players in the preventive healthcare landscape. The UK government is actively promoting initiatives aimed at enhancing the role of pharmacies in public health, including expanding the scope of services offered, such as vaccination programs and health screenings. As a result, pharmacies are increasingly viewed as essential healthcare providers within communities.
Market Segmentation Insights
By Product Type: Prescription Drugs vs. Over-The-Counter Drugs
Prescription Drugs dominate the UK pharmacy market due to their critical role in treating various medical conditions, with a strong emphasis on chronic illness management. Over-The-Counter Drugs are emerging rapidly as consumers increasingly seek accessible healthcare solutions for minor ailments, contributing to a shift in consumer behavior towards self-care.
By Therapeutic Area: Cardiovascular vs. Oncology
Cardiovascular treatments maintain a significant lead, driven by the increasing prevalence of heart-related diseases. Oncology has emerged as a fast-growing segment, fueled by advancements in cancer research and the growing demand for innovative therapies. The rising number of cardiovascular cases has prompted healthcare providers to enhance treatment options, while oncology's rapid growth stems from increasing investments in research and development.
By Distribution Channel: Retail Pharmacy vs. Online Pharmacy
Retail Pharmacy holds the largest share, providing an array of products and essential health services. The Online Pharmacy segment is rapidly gaining traction, fueled by changing consumer behaviors and the convenience of purchasing medications online. Convenience, competitive pricing, and the ability to access specialty medications online are significant drivers of this growth.
The Role of Integrated Healthcare Models
The pharmacy market is witnessing a shift towards integrated healthcare models, which emphasize collaboration among healthcare providers. This approach aims to deliver more coordinated and comprehensive care to patients. In the UK, pharmacies are increasingly partnering with general practitioners and hospitals to ensure seamless patient transitions and continuity of care. Such collaborations enhance the role of pharmacies in managing patient health, particularly for those with complex medical needs, fostering a more holistic approach to patient care.
Future Outlook
The Pharmacy Market in the UK is projected to grow at a 4.6% CAGR from 2025 to 2035. New opportunities lie in the expansion of telepharmacy services to enhance patient access, development of personalized medication management systems for chronic disease patients, and implementation of AI-driven inventory management solutions. By 2035, the pharmacy market is expected to achieve robust growth, positioning itself as a key player in healthcare.
